Auto-defrost freezers cycle temperatures up and down daily, actively sucking moisture out of poorly wrapped meat.
Expected Peak Quality Lifespan
| Storage Type | Packaging | Peak Quality Lifespan |
|---|---|---|
| Deep Chest Freezer | Commercial Vacuum | 2 - 3 Years |
| Deep Chest Freezer | Butcher Paper | 9 - 12 Months |
| Auto-Defrost Upright | Home Vacuum | 12 - 18 Months |
| Kitchen Combo | Zip-Top Bag | 1 - 3 Months |
Precision Master Protocol
-
1Step 1: Always ensure meat is completely dry on the surface before vacuum sealing to prevent ice crystal formation inside the bag.
-
2Step 2: Double wrap if using butcher paper: first tightly in plastic wrap, then heavy-duty freezer paper.
-
3Step 3: Keep the freezer at least 75% full. Mass retains cold during auto-defrost cycles.
-
4Step 4: Rotate stock using the First-In, First-Out (FIFO) method.
-
5Step 5: Trim away any grey, dry spots before cooking; the meat underneath is perfectly safe.
